Abstract

The invention is suitable for the technical field of microwave / millimeter wave testing, and provides a noise parameter determination method and device for a microwave noise receiver, and the method comprises the steps: calibrating a noise parameter measurement system, and carrying out the measurement through the calibrated noise parameter measurement system, and obtaining a noise-related parameter; establishing a linear overdetermined equation of the noise receiver according to the noise related parameters; and solving the linear overdetermined equation to obtain the value of the unknown column vector, and calculating the noise parameter of the noise receiver according to the value of the unknown column vector, thereby representing the noise parameter of the noise receiver. According to the invention, a high-precision noise parameter measurement system is used to measure noise-related parameters. The linear overdetermined equation is set and solved by using the least square method, andthe noise parameter of the noise receiver is calculated according to the unknown column vector of the obtained linear overdetermined equation, so that the noise parameter measurement precision is relatively high, the noise parameter calculation method is simple, and the noise parameter measurement efficiency can be improved.

technical field [0001] The invention belongs to the technical field of microwave / millimeter wave testing, and in particular relates to a method and device for determining noise parameters of a microwave noise receiver. Background technique [0002] Noise figure is a quality factor used to describe the amount of excessive noise in a system, so reducing the noise figure to a minimum can reduce the impact of noise on the system. Noise parameters include the minimum noise figure F min , the best source reflection coefficient Γ opt and equivalent noise resistance R n . [0003] The most common noise parameter measurement system currently used is composed of a noise source and a noise figure meter. The noise source provides a standard noise signal, and the noise figure meter measures the noise when the noise source is at two different resource noise powers (or different noise temperatures).
